Tint Screen

by Matt Spencer

Want a different perspective on life with your computer? Have a late-night project with sore eyes from the glare? Then change the way you look at your monitor(s) with Tint Screen. It smoothly fades a color or image in/out of your screen(s) and has a wide array of other customizable features.

Requires Y!WE 3.1+ due to the flat-file format used. Also requires the Microsoft .NET 2.0 Framework for screen capturing on Windows. To move this Widget, you must hold control (Win) or command (Mac), click, and drag.

Zip file contains the Widget and a readme file containing everything you need to know.
